Transaction 3284962e011cfc62a90344f2f379aeb68ab70a07126f3274ff7351635b625878
2 Input
2 Outputs
- 3284962e011cfc62a90344f2f379aeb68ab70a07126f3274ff7351635b625878:0
- 3284962e011cfc62a90344f2f379aeb68ab70a07126f3274ff7351635b625878:1
value 289340000
address 1KTyoMoELMBF4FcgKVe7RDKGHJ3G8xWsHj
value 39432220
address 1Po4J4SNyJuGnMGYJfGTXLEvGgAZKiddr7